22 # --config add the given configuration file, which will be read after
23 # any "Configurations*" files that are found in the same
24 # directory as this script.
25 # --prefix prefix for the OpenSSL installation, which includes the
26 # directories bin, lib, include, share/man, share/doc/openssl
27 # This becomes the value of INSTALLTOP in Makefile
28 # (Default: /usr/local)
29 # --openssldir OpenSSL data area, such as openssl.cnf, certificates and keys.
30 # If it's a relative directory, it will be added on the directory
31 # given with --prefix.
32 # This becomes the value of OPENSSLDIR in Makefile and in C.
33 # (Default: PREFIX/ssl)
35 # --cross-compile-prefix Add specified prefix to binutils components.
37 # --api One of 0.9.8, 1.0.0 or 1.1.0. Do not compile support for
38 # interfaces deprecated as of the specified OpenSSL version.
40 # no-hw-xxx do not compile support for specific crypto hardware.
41 # Generic OpenSSL-style methods relating to this support
42 # are always compiled but return NULL if the hardware
43 # support isn't compiled.
44 # no-hw do not compile support for any crypto hardware.
45 # [no-]threads [don't] try to create a library that is suitable for
46 # multithreaded applications (default is "threads" if we
48 # [no-]shared [don't] try to create shared libraries when supported.
49 # no-asm do not use assembler
50 # no-dso do not compile in any native shared-library methods. This
51 # will ensure that all methods just return NULL.
52 # no-egd do not compile support for the entropy-gathering daemon APIs
53 # [no-]zlib [don't] compile support for zlib compression.
54 # zlib-dynamic Like "zlib", but the zlib library is expected to be a shared
55 # library and will be loaded in run-time by the OpenSSL library.
56 # sctp include SCTP support
57 # 386 generate 80386 code
58 # no-sse2 disables IA-32 SSE2 code, above option implies no-sse2
59 # no-<cipher> build without specified algorithm (rsa, idea, rc5, ...)
60 # -<xxx> +<xxx> compiler options are passed through
62 # DEBUG_SAFESTACK use type-safe stacks to enforce type-safety on stack items
63 # provided to stack calls. Generates unique stack functions for
64 # each possible stack type.
65 # BN_LLONG use the type 'long long' in crypto/bn/bn.h
66 # RC4_CHAR use 'char' instead of 'int' for RC4_INT in crypto/rc4/rc4.h
67 # Following are set automatically by this script
69 # MD5_ASM use some extra md5 assember,
70 # SHA1_ASM use some extra sha1 assember, must define L_ENDIAN for x86
71 # RMD160_ASM use some extra ripemd160 assember,
72 # SHA256_ASM sha256_block is implemented in assembler
73 # SHA512_ASM sha512_block is implemented in assembler
74 # AES_ASM ASE_[en|de]crypt is implemented in assembler
